摘要
The ac magnetoresistance of thin films at frequencies up to 10 kHz was successfully measured. Patterned electrodes with mechanical flexibility were pressed onto the film surface by using a rubber pad. Induction noises were reduced considerably in comparison to the conventional four-electrode method. A seven-electrode system was developed to prevent high-frequency induction noise, typically induced by leakage flux from the sample edges. It was found that the seven-electrode system enables magnetoresistance measurements with little induction noise at frequencies up to 10 kHz. (C) 2000 Scripta Technica.
